Dental care can be one of the most important needs in medical care, however, if it is cost-effective, your needs can be met. Once you give up dental care, you may develop more serious health problems.

Apart from the chances of losing teeth, it can also affect your heart, brain, and immune system.

According to the American Dental Association (ADA), a gum disease that causes tooth loss (known as periodontitis) is related to other more serious health conditions, like bacterial pneumonia, stroke, and cardiovascular condition. Other studies show that an unhealthy mouth can be linked to diabetes.

Without proper dental care, small cavities or painful teeth can lead to more severe problems than tooth decay. You shouldn’t delay making a consultation.

How lower price dental plans differ from conventional insurance:
Instant Savings: When you are on a regular membership plan, you obtain a 10% to 60% off. You have to pay the dental professional directly for their services, and there are no hidden charges.

For instance, you need a process that usually costs $280. As a part of the discount network, you are qualified to receive a 60% discount on this treatment.

As a result, you will only spend $ 120 to have your dental care fixed ($ 300 – 60% = $ 120). No other service fees will be placed. This subsidized rate enables you to quickly get affordable dental care.

No paperwork issues: With common insurance plan, there is a long waiting period that you need to undergo while the insurance provider decides whether or not you meet the criteria for insurance coverage. This is called the underwriting period.

There’s no long underwriting period with a reduction plan. Your membership becomes active within three days from the moment you sign up for the discount network. If you decide on an insurance for your loved ones, they will be insured at the same time as you.

No monthly bills: There are no monthly payments to pay for. After you have signed up for your discount plan, you’ll be insured for a throughout the year.

No deductions: There’s no deductible to pay before your benefits are applied. Once you are a member of the network, you’re fully qualified to receive member savings. The dental professionals provide their dental services to members at a significantly reduced rate.

All dentists in the dental network are accredited by the board in their area of specialty. Membership coverage includes emergency treatments and preventative including cleanings, root canals, fillings, bridges, crowns, orthodontics, extractions, X-rays and a lot more. Tactics to reduce your pricey dental care

Getting cosmetic dentistry and dental care in different areas Ortonville Michigan and anywhere in the world, especially in developed countries can be outrageously expensive irrespective of having access to some kind of dental coverage.

In a survey (1999-2004), the National Health and Nutrition Examination Survey (NHANES) learned that 3.75% of adults aged 20 to 64 didn’t have teeth remaining. In 2010, virtually 45 million Americans lacked dental insurance, according to statistics from the US federal agency CDC.

Many people with a regular income and without insurance avoid their dentist consultations because of the high charges associated with pain.

However, delaying the necessary dental care or control may expose them to more expensive and longer-term dental treatments. It’s understandable that oral and dental problems can aggravate a person’s dental health if not cured immediately.

If you need dental treatment or surgery, but are terrified of the high dentist’s bill, following helpful suggestions can save you funds on your dental care.

Here are useful tips for lowering the cost of dental treatment for the insured and the uninsured.

Stay away from frequent X-rays: Your dentist may suggest a dental x-ray on your first visit, a scheduled check-up, or a return for treatment.

But the American Dental Association (ADA) advises that the regularity of visits to the dentist’s X-ray chair be determined by the current condition of the patient’s dental health.

Hence, if you have good dental health, you simply do not need dental x-rays at every appointment to the dentist.

Through taking an X-ray with your teeth less often, you can’t only save a lot of money, but it will also prevent you from being in contact with possibly damaging X-rays.

Use negotiation: An additional way to lessen the cost of your dental treatment is to speak with your dentist with regards to payment choices during the first consultation.

After having a clear thought of what will or will not be included in the dentist’s fees, you can claim a discount on the dental bill.

Your medical provider and dental center can offer you various payment choices. Don’t be scared to pay for your dental bills monthly or quarterly.

Exchange: It may sound crazy, but you can acquire free dental treatment through the barter system. Individuals with various professional capabilities and services, like carpentry or web page design, can modify their dental treatment services.

For instance, you can make an online site for your dental professional or give plumbing, mechanics or other facility in exchange for the price of dental care.

Searching for Dentistry at a School of Dentistry: To boost the size of your dental savings, take into consideration doing your dental treatment at a dental institution, where dental procedures will be performed by students under the supervision of certified dentists at a fraction of what you would pay in the center of a private dentist.

Brush and floss every single day: More notably, if you’d like to save some money, you should pay attention to your dental health.

Remember to brush your teeth two times daily or after every meal and floss at least once a day to avoid the risk of oral issues. Reduce your sugar consumption to reduce your dental issues.

Dental tips for healthy teeth

Dental care is vital for healthy teeth. This element of dental health is necessary as it contributes considerably to the general health.

Though regular consultation with a dental expert is a great means to have the information you need concerning proper dental care, minor alterations to your daily diet and oral care routine can reduce your time spent at the dentist.

By having appropriate dental care, you’ll avoid stinky breath, gum disease, enhance your general health, and spend less on expensive dental treatments. Here are some tips on dental treatment that, if followed, will help you maintain healthy teeth that can last a long time.

Floss and brush

Clean and healthy teeth are the beginning of dental health. Routine use of dental floss and brushing of teeth is crucial to maintain your gums and teeth healthy and healthy. Brush your teeth twice a day with a fluoride toothpaste that helps prevent teeth cavities.

Don’t be in a rush. Rather, take time to brush your teeth. Do not forget to use a brush that matches the structure of your mouth and the position of your teeth.

Your toothbrush must be soft and well rounded. Also, clean the tongue in order to avoid stinky breath and be sure to replace your brush every two months.

Daily dental flossing is important. Flossing can help you reach the rigid spaces between your teeth and underneath the gum line. Rub the sides of your teeth gently with floss and do not skimp.

In case you have difficulty flossing between your teeth, use waxed dental floss. Be as careful as possible when flossing in order to avoid hurting your gums. Furthermore, consider providing dental prostheses as real teeth in your dental habits.

Watch your diet

Avoid sweet goodies as too much-refined sugar increases the growth of the plaque. Make sure you drink and eat healthier foods, such as low-fat milk products, whole wheat, and green vegetables.

Drink lots of water to remain hydrated. Stay away from carbonated drinks such as soda and caffeine, as they can dehydrate you and damage your teeth.

Do not use cigarettes and tobacco products as they cause gum illness and oral cancer. It should be kept in mind that eating healthy should be part of your daily routine and is as critical as flossing and brushing your teeth.

Regular dental appointments

It is important to make annual appointments with your dentist, whatever the strength of your teeth. Make sure to check your mouth between dental consultations.

If chips, lumps, unusual changes, or red bumps are found in the mouth, consult a dental professional immediately. With this routine, you can save a lot of money on gum and tooth ailments.

Your dentist will give comprehensive treatments that will guarantee a cleaner and healthier mouth. Go to the dentist depending on how often you will need cleaning and check-up.
